AI companies are increasingly seeking access to employees' work-related data, including emails and documents, to train AI models in simulated workplace environments. Google and AI startup Mercor have paid millions for corporate data from bankrupt Spirit Airlines. Handshake AI offers individuals up to $30,000 for high-quality written work documents, raising questions about data privacy and ownership.
